Cómo Crear una Base de Datos MySQL en cPanel
Las bases de datos MySQL son la columna vertebral de la mayoría de las aplicaciones web dinámicas, incluyendo sistemas de gestión de contenido (CMS) como WordPress, Joomla, o tiendas en línea como PrestaShop y Magento. Permiten almacenar, organizar y recuperar eficientemente grandes volúmenes de información, desde el contenido de su sitio hasta los datos de sus usuarios y configuraciones.
En PlatiniumHost, la gestión de sus bases de datos MySQL se simplifica enormemente gracias al panel de control cPanel. Esta guía detallada le llevará a través de los pasos esenciales para crear una base de datos MySQL, establecer un usuario dedicado para ella y asignar los permisos adecuados. Al finalizar este tutorial, tendrá una base de datos MySQL completamente configurada y lista para ser utilizada por su aplicación web.
Paso 1: Acceder a su cPanel
El primer paso fundamental es iniciar sesión en su panel de control cPanel. Por lo general, puede acceder a cPanel a través de una URL específica proporcionada por PlatiniumHost, que suele seguir el formato su-dominio.com/cpanel o cpanel.su-dominio.com. Utilice el nombre de usuario y la contraseña de su cuenta de hosting para iniciar sesión.
Paso 2: Crear la Base de Datos MySQL
Una vez que haya iniciado sesión en cPanel, diríjase a la sección 'Bases de datos' y haga clic en el icono 'Bases de datos MySQL'.
- En la sección 'Crear una nueva base de datos', encontrará un campo etiquetado como 'Nueva base de datos:'. Introduzca el nombre deseado para su base de datos. Por ejemplo, si su sitio es 'misitio', podría usar 'misitio_db'.
- Haga clic en el botón 'Crear base de datos'.
cPanel añadirá automáticamente un prefijo a su nombre de base de datos, generalmente el nombre de usuario de su cuenta cPanel seguido de un guion bajo (por ejemplo, usuario_misitio_db). Es crucial que anote este nombre completo, ya que lo necesitará para configurar su aplicación web.
Paso 3: Crear un Usuario MySQL
Una vez que la base de datos ha sido creada, es necesario establecer un usuario específico que tendrá acceso a ella. Por razones de seguridad, es una buena práctica no utilizar el usuario principal de cPanel para la base de datos. Desplácese hacia abajo hasta la sección 'Usuarios MySQL' y siga estos pasos:
- En la sección 'Añadir nuevo usuario', ingrese un nombre de usuario en el campo 'Nombre de usuario:'. Por ejemplo, 'misitio_user'.
- Introduzca una contraseña robusta en el campo 'Contraseña:' y repítala en el campo 'Contraseña (de nuevo):'.
- Haga clic en el botón 'Crear usuario'.
Al igual que con la base de datos, cPanel aplicará un prefijo a su nombre de usuario (por ejemplo, usuario_misitio_user). Es fundamental que guarde este nombre de usuario completo y la contraseña en un lugar seguro, ya que son credenciales vitales para la configuración de su aplicación.
Paso 4: Asignar el Usuario a la Base de Datos
Ahora que tiene una base de datos y un usuario, el siguiente paso es conectar ambos elementos, otorgando al usuario la capacidad de interactuar con la base de datos. Desplácese hacia abajo hasta la sección 'Añadir usuario a la base de datos'.
- En el menú desplegable 'Usuario:', seleccione el usuario MySQL que acaba de crear (por ejemplo,
usuario_misitio_user). - En el menú desplegable 'Base de datos:', seleccione la base de datos MySQL que creó anteriormente (por ejemplo,
usuario_misitio_db). - Haga clic en el botón 'Añadir'.
Paso 5: Otorgar Privilegios al Usuario
Después de asignar el usuario a la base de datos, cPanel le redirigirá automáticamente a una página donde podrá definir los privilegios del usuario. Estos privilegios dictan qué acciones puede realizar el usuario dentro de esa base de datos (por ejemplo, crear tablas, insertar, actualizar o eliminar datos, etc.).
- Para la gran mayoría de las aplicaciones web, el usuario necesitará tener control total sobre la base de datos. Por lo tanto, marque la casilla 'TODOS LOS PRIVILEGIOS'.
- Haga clic en el botón 'Hacer cambios'.
¡Felicidades! Ha completado exitosamente la creación de una base de datos MySQL, ha establecido un usuario dedicado y le ha asignado todos los privilegios necesarios. Su base de datos ahora está completamente lista para ser utilizada por su aplicación.
Conclusión
Crear una base de datos MySQL en cPanel con su servicio de PlatiniumHost es un proceso directo y eficiente. Ahora dispone de los tres datos esenciales: el nombre completo de la base de datos, el nombre completo del usuario de la base de datos y la contraseña de este usuario. Estos detalles serán requeridos cuando configure su aplicación web (como WordPress, Joomla, etc.), generalmente en un archivo de configuración específico.
Si en algún momento encuentra alguna dificultad o tiene preguntas adicionales, no dude en ponerse en contacto con el equipo de soporte técnico de PlatiniumHost. Estaremos encantados de brindarle la asistencia necesaria.